on: push: jobs: backend-pylint: runs-on: docker container: nikolaik/python-nodejs:python3.11-nodejs21 steps: - name: Checkout source code uses: https://code.forgejo.org/actions/checkout@v3 - name: Install packages working-directory: ./backend run: | pip install -e . -q python -m pip list --format=columns --disable-pip-version-check pip install pylint~=2.17.7 --disable-pip-version-check -q - name: Run pylint working-directory: ./backend run: | pylint --version pylint **/*.py --exit-zero